Calendar for the 2002 Season

The Hudson River Maritime Museum opens to the public on May 4, the weekend of the annual Kingston shad festival. This year's museum exhibit, created in cooperation with Kingston's 350th Anniversary Celebration, will focus on the maritime history of Hudson River related to Kingston. Scheduled boat rides to the Rondout Lighthouse will begin this weekend. Some of the major events for 2002 include:
